The University of Northern Iowa department of athletics announced today an agreement for KXNO (1460-AM) radio to become an affiliate on the UNI Sports Network for the 2008 football season.

"It is certainly great news to have a sports radio station as strong as KXNO as the voice of the Panthers in central Iowa," UNI Director of Athletics Troy Dannen said. "This opportunity is significant to the University of Northern Iowa and to Panther fans and alumni as they all continue to support Panther athletics."

"We are thrilled to have Northern Iowa Football on KXNO in Des Moines," said Joel McCrea, V.P./Market Manager for Clear Channel Radio Des Moines/Ames. "Troy Dannen and his staff made sure that we could not say no to this deal. The addition of Learfield Sports to the UNI Marketing mix was also a big factor in our decision. We have a long, good relationship with Learfield and the other two state universities. We are excited to have Gary Rima and Scott Peterson on KXNO, their personalities match KXNO's personality very well."

The UNI football season will get underway when the Panthers take on the No. 16-ranked Brigham Young University Cougars on Aug. 30 at 5 p.m. (Central).
